Good Reference Book
If you have enough paper and enough ink you're sure to produce something relevant in the end. Some good material, sometimes too much description, there are diagrams, some are very good, but fewer words and more diagrams might have been better. There are examples & exercises all exhaustive.There are some differences with the terminology being a US production, but all easily translatable. Probably best as a basic or refresh reference book. If this tome was the only book on the topic, some might give up at the first fence.The size & volume of this book make the whole subject seem unnecessarily daunting. When one compares this with Mary Blewitt's slim little volume of 60 odd pages on Celestial Navigation which is so much clearer, succinct and just as comprehensive, one would inevitably choose the latter.

Simply the best investment in any nautical book to date...
Having done a proper RYA course on this subject twice in the last 15 years this was the first time that I really began to understand what the subject was about rather than simply complete a course. The workbook is designed to inspire you to explore the reasons why something is the way it is rather than simply a descriptive definition of the terms and theory involved. I now understand not just how to use the Nautical Almanac but how it is constructed so that I can double check its figures without assuming they must be correct because its an official publication. The joy in realising that you do understand not just the concepts or the theory but how to apply that knowledge (which will always be in your head rather than a PC) in a vast variety of circumstances really makes you appreciate the wonderful clockwork of the heavens above but also the sheer mastery that our ancient mariners had when they used this knowledge in the confidence that they could safely navigate the oceans around them. In short BUY this book and master this "black" art for ever. One day your GPS will die : the knowledge and the confidence gained by completing this workbook will not.ThanksPeter B.
